SIL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2014 in Review
47 of the 3,750 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Global X Silver Miners ETF NEW (SIL) for Q4 2014, worth a combined $29.5M — up 15% from $25.7M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 13 funds opened new SIL positions and 8 closed out — a net gain of 5 holders — while 16 added to existing stakes and 10 trimmed.
The largest buyer was AssetMark Inc, opening a new position worth an estimated $3.51M. The largest seller was Royal Bank of Canada, cutting an estimated $1.23M.
